Digital Marketing Strategies for Comedy Club businesses
1. Keyword Research: Identify keywords related to comedy, stand-up shows, and local entertainment. Use tools like Google Keyword Planner to find phrases such as "comedy shows near me," "stand-up comedy in [City]," and "live comedy events."
2. Optimized Website Content: Create engaging content that highlights upcoming shows, featured comedians, and club history. Ensure that all content includes relevant keywords naturally to improve search engine visibility.
3. Local SEO: Optimize your Google My Business listing with accurate information, including the club’s name, address, phone number, and hours. Encourage customers to leave reviews, which can enhance your local ranking.
4. Blogging: Start a blog on your website that covers topics like “Top 10 Comedians to See This Month” or “Comedy Tips for Aspiring Stand-up Artists.” This not only attracts traffic but positions your club as a go-to resource for comedy enthusiasts.
5. Backlink Strategy: Partner with local businesses or entertainment blogs to promote your club and gain backlinks. This can improve domain authority and help in rankings. Social Media Strategies
1. Platform Selection: Focus on platforms like Instagram, Facebook, and TikTok where visual and short-form video content thrives. These platforms are ideal for showcasing live performances and behind-the-scenes content.
2. Engaging Content: Share clips from performances, funny memes, and promotional material for upcoming shows. Use Instagram Stories and Reels to create a sense of urgency and excitement around events.
3. Community Engagement: Foster a community vibe by interacting with followers. Respond to comments, host Q&A sessions with comedians, and encourage user-generated content by asking attendees to share their experiences.
4. Event Promotion: Use Facebook Events to promote shows, allowing fans to RSVP and share with friends. Regularly post event reminders and updates to keep your audience engaged.
5. Influencer Collaborations: Partner with local comedians or influencers who can promote your shows to their followers, providing access to a broader audience. PPC Strategies
1. Google Ads: Use targeted Google Ads to promote upcoming shows. Focus on local keywords and optimize your ad copy to highlight special deals, such as discounts for first-time visitors.
2. Social Media Ads: Create captivating ad campaigns on Facebook and Instagram that feature video snippets of performances or testimonials from previous attendees. Target specific demographics to reach potential comedy fans in your area.
3. Retargeting Campaigns: Implement retargeting ads to reach individuals who have previously visited your website or engaged with your social media content. This can help convert interest into ticket sales.
4. Event-Specific Promotions: Run limited-time promotions for specific events, such as “Buy One Get One Free” tickets, to create urgency and drive ticket sales.
5. Analytics Tracking: Regularly analyze the performance of your PPC campaigns using tools like Google Analytics and Facebook Insights. Adjust your strategy based on what is driving the highest engagement and conversions. By integrating these digital marketing strategies into your overall marketing plan, you can effectively boost visibility, engage your audience, and drive ticket sales for your Comedy Club.
Offline Marketing Strategies for Comedy Club businesses
1. Local Press Releases: Craft engaging press releases to announce upcoming shows, special events, or comedian lineups. Distribute these to local newspapers, magazines, and radio stations to gain media coverage.
2. Networking with Local Businesses: Partner with nearby restaurants, bars, and entertainment venues for cross-promotions. This could include offering discounts for customers who visit both establishments or hosting joint events.
3. Community Events: Participate in or sponsor local festivals, fairs, or community gatherings. Set up a booth to promote your club and offer free tickets or merchandise to draw attention.
4. Comedy Nights at Local Venues: Organize comedy nights at local bars or community centers. This allows you to showcase your talent and attract new audiences who might not have visited your club yet.
5. Print Advertising: Invest in ads in local newspapers, entertainment magazines, and community bulletins. Highlight upcoming shows and unique features of your club to capture the attention of potential customers.
6. Direct Mail Campaigns: Create eye-catching postcards or flyers advertising upcoming events and send them to targeted neighborhoods or demographics within your city.
7. Posters and Flyers: Design visually appealing posters and flyers to hang in high-traffic areas, such as coffee shops, libraries, and community boards. Ensure they include essential information and a call to action.
8. Loyalty Programs: Implement a loyalty program where frequent attendees can earn rewards or discounts. Promote this through printed materials at the club and during events.
9. Street Teams: Recruit enthusiastic local comedians or fans to promote your club by distributing flyers or putting up posters in strategic locations.
10. Charity Events: Host charity comedy shows where a portion of the proceeds goes to a local cause. This fosters community goodwill and draws in people who support the charity.
11. Workshops and Classes: Organize comedy workshops or improv classes to engage the community and establish your club as a hub for comedy talent development.
12. Print Merchandise: Sell or give away branded merchandise, such as T-shirts or mugs, that promotes your comedy club and can be worn or used in the local community.
13. VIP Events: Host exclusive events for local influencers, press, and community leaders. This can create buzz and lead to word-of-mouth marketing.
14. Seasonal Promotions: Develop seasonal marketing campaigns aligned with holidays or events, offering special deals or themed shows to attract different audiences.
15. Networking with Influencers: Build relationships with local influencers or bloggers who can help promote your events through their platforms and networks. By integrating these offline strategies into your marketing plan, your comedy club can effectively build brand awareness and attract more customers.

1. What is the first step in creating a marketing plan for my comedy club? The first step is to conduct thorough market research. Understand your target audience, identify your competition, and analyze the local entertainment landscape. This will help you define your unique selling proposition (USP) and tailor your marketing strategies effectively. ####
2. How can I identify my target audience for a comedy club? Your target audience can be identified through demographic analysis (age, gender, income level) and psychographic profiling (interests, behaviors, preferences). Consider hosting a survey or using social media insights to gather information about potential customers who enjoy live comedy. ####
3. What marketing channels are most effective for promoting a comedy club? Effective marketing channels for a comedy club include social media platforms (like Instagram, Facebook, and TikTok), local event listings, email newsletters, partnerships with local businesses, and collaborations with comedians for promotional content. Additionally, consider using video marketing to showcase performances. ####
4. How often should I update my comedy club's marketing plan? Your marketing plan should be a living document that you revisit and adjust at least quarterly. Regular updates allow you to respond to changing market conditions, audience preferences, and new marketing trends effectively. ####
5. What types of promotions work best for attracting customers to a comedy club? Promotions such as discounted tickets for first-time visitors, group discounts, themed nights, and special events featuring popular comedians can attract customers. Additionally, consider using social media contests or giveaways to increase engagement and reach. ####
6. Should I focus on online or offline marketing strategies? A balanced approach is ideal. While online marketing (social media, email campaigns, and SEO) allows for broader reach and real-time engagement, offline strategies (flyers, local radio ads, and community events) help you connect with the local community and build a loyal audience. ####
7. How can I leverage social media for my comedy club's marketing? Use social media to share funny clips from performances, behind-the-scenes content, and updates about upcoming shows. Engage with your audience through polls, Q&A sessions, and live streams. Collaborating with comedians for social media takeovers can also boost visibility. ####
8. What role does SEO play in my comedy club's marketing plan? SEO is crucial for driving organic traffic to your website. Optimize your website with relevant keywords related to comedy shows, local events, and entertainment. Create quality content like blog posts about comedy tips, comedian interviews, or event recaps to improve your search engine visibility. ####
9. How can I measure the success of my marketing efforts? Utilize various analytics tools to track website traffic, social media engagement, ticket sales, and email open rates. Set clear KPIs (Key Performance Indicators) for each marketing channel and regularly analyze the data to assess the effectiveness of your strategies. ####
10. What common mistakes should I avoid when marketing my comedy club? Avoid neglecting your online presence, failing to engage with your audience, and not tracking your marketing performance. Additionally, ensure you don’t over-rely on a single marketing channel; diversify your strategies to reach a broader audience.
